Quick Verdict
The Zilla Thermometer-Hygrometer offers accurate readings and is easy to use, but durability and initial setup issues are concerning. Users report mixed experiences with longevity and functionality, making it a risky purchase for some reptile owners.

Common Questions
Is the Zilla Thermometer-Hygrometer durable?
User reviews indicate mixed durability, with some experiencing immediate issues like melted wires and others reporting long-term functionality. Regular maintenance is recommended to extend longevity.
Is this product waterproof?
No, it is not waterproof. Users have reported it as not suitable for water-based terrariums or humid conditions.
